《超市管理系统:VC++与SQLServer的协同应用》 在当今信息化社会,高效的管理系统对于各行各业,尤其是零售业来说,已经成为不可或缺的一部分。本文将深入探讨一个基于VC++编程语言和SQLServer数据库系统的超市管理系统的设计与实现,旨在揭示两者如何协同工作,提升超市的运营效率。 一、VC++简介 VC++,全称Microsoft Visual C++,是微软公司开发的一款集成开发环境,主要用于编写Windows平台下的应用程序。它支持C++语言,并提供了丰富的类库,包括MFC(Microsoft Foundation Classes),方便开发者构建用户界面,处理系统资源,以及进行网络和数据库操作。 二、SQLServer基础 SQLServer是微软公司的关系型数据库管理系统,适用于企业级的数据存储和管理。其特点包括强大的数据处理能力、高可用性、安全性和可扩展性。SQLServer支持多种数据库操作语言,如T-SQL,使得开发者可以高效地进行数据查询、更新和管理。 三、系统架构 超市管理系统通常由前端用户界面和后端数据库两部分组成。前端使用VC++的MFC库创建图形用户界面(GUI),用户可以通过直观的操作界面进行商品管理、销售记录、库存查询等操作。后端则通过SQLServer存储和处理所有业务数据。 四、VC++与SQLServer的接口 在VC++中,我们通常使用ODBC(Open Database Connectivity)或ADO(ActiveX Data Objects)来连接和操作SQLServer数据库。ODBC提供了一种标准的接口,使得不同的数据库系统能被统一访问;而ADO则是微软提供的高级数据访问接口,它更易于使用,功能更强大。 五、主要功能模块 1. 商品管理:添加、修改、删除商品信息,包括商品名称、价格、库存等。 2. 销售记录:记录每笔销售交易,包括商品、数量、总价、顾客信息等。 3. 库存控制:实时更新库存,预警低库存商品,避免断货风险。 4. 报表分析:生成销售报表、库存报表,帮助管理者决策。 六、安全性与性能优化 系统应确保数据的安全性,如使用加密技术保护敏感信息,设置权限控制不同角色的用户访问。同时,通过合理的数据库设计和SQL语句优化,提高查询效率,减少数据库负载。 七、系统测试与维护 在系统开发完成后,需进行详尽的测试,包括单元测试、集成测试和压力测试,确保其稳定性和准确性。系统上线后,定期维护和升级是必不可少的,以适应业务变化和技术进步。 总结,超市管理系统结合了VC++的编程灵活性和SQLServer的强大数据库管理功能,实现了高效的数据处理和业务流程自动化。通过理解这两个工具的协同工作,开发者可以构建出满足实际需求的高效系统,为超市的日常运营提供强有力的支持。
- 1
- 粉丝: 5
- 资源: 243
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 三相桥式全控整流电路simulink仿真(阻性 阻感性负载) 2021版本
- 基于二阶锥规划的主动配电网最优潮流求解 参考文献:主动配电网多源协同运行优化研究-乔珊 摘要:最优潮流研究在配 电网规划运行 中不可或缺 , 且在大量分布式能源接入 的主动配 电网环境下尤 为重要
- 混合动力汽车性能分析与simulink建模,采用成熟软件架构,利用桌面应用程序接收用户配置,并自动控制MATLAB运行,并将结果返回桌面应用程序进行显示 以每个部件的模型、控制模型、初始化、前 后处
- 基于卷积神经网络CNN的数据回归预测 多输入单输出预测 代码含详细注释,不负责 数据存入Excel,替方便,指标计算有决定系数R2,平均绝对误差MAE,平均相对误差MBE
- 混合储能,simulink模型储能并网,混合储能能量管理 电池与超级电容混合储能并网matlab simulink仿真模型 (1)混合储能采用低通滤波器进行功率分配,可有效抑制系统功率波动,实现母
- STM32低成本MD500E永磁同步,单电阻采样,无感算法方案,高性价比变频器方案 md500e单电阻采样:精简移植了md500e的无感svc部分到f103中,值得研究学习,电子资料,出不 包括
- 多孔集流体模型模拟锌枝晶生长过程,仿真锌离子在电极表面吸附沉积的过程,通过三次电流分布接口,相场接口进行仿真,对比锌枝晶文献可以肉眼可见的清晰模拟出锌表面沉积过程
- 光伏板向蓄电池充电,恒流恒压法 根据网上频搭建的,可以跟着学,内有一些自己的理解注释 2018b
- 企业展示型百度小程序 智能小程序 小程序 模板 源代码下载
- 无电网电压传感器三相PWM整流器,采用磁链方法估算电网相位角度 模型控制器部分全部采用离散化处理,设置成单采样单更新模式,SVPWM调制模式,开关频率固定,使用的是矢量控制技术 该模型SVPWM模
- Matlab仿真:转速闭环转差频率控制异步电动机的矢量控制(付设计说明) 2021b及以上版本
- 永磁同步电机多物理场仿真案例,电磁-谐响应-噪声分析(NVH分析),该案例可以用于学习,具体参数见第一张图
- 自立袋产品品自动装盒并装箱sw22全套技术资料100%好用.zip
- 制作abaqus隧道CD法开挖,CD法开挖讲 解,CD法开挖模型,step by step,CRD法开挖模型,台阶法开挖,环形开挖预留核心土法开挖,模型,讲 解详细
- 考虑充电需求差异性的电动汽车协同充放电调度方法 关键词:充电需求差异性 电动汽车协同充放电 调度 仿真软件: matlab + yalmip +cplex 研究内容:代码提出了一种微电网中电动汽车的协
- FactoryIO自动分拣+堆垛机+入库仿真,PLC学习最佳模型 使用简单的梯形图与SCL语言编写,通俗易懂,写有详细注释,起到抛砖引玉的作用,比较适合有动手能力的入门初学者,和入门学习,程序可以无限
评论0